Endocrine Surgeons in Perth are renowned for their expertise in diagnosing and treating conditions that affect the endocrine system. This system, a complex network of glands and organs, is responsible for producing hormones that regulate the body’s growth, metabolism, and reproduction. These surgeons are specially trained to handle a variety of endocrine-related conditions, including thyroid cancer, parathyroid disease, adrenal tumours, and pituitary tumours.

Using a range of surgical techniques, these surgeons skillfully remove or destroy diseased tissue while preserving healthy tissue. Their goal is to manage and treat endocrine disorders effectively, ensuring the best possible outcomes for their patients.
